What does a fox mean symbolically?

Symbolism and meaning of the fox include intelligence, independence, playfulness and mischief, beauty, protection, and good fortune. Foxes may be found on every continent except Antarctica, making them a part of many cultures’ mythology and folklore.

What are some things that symbolize insanity?

The full moon symbolizes insanity, it is “luna” in the term “lunacy”. Poppies are often a symbol of sleep and death, but can also symbolize madness because they are the source of opium. For the same reason, magic mushrooms.

What is an insane object Message?

The insane object message is what LabVIEW puts in a dialog when one of the objects on the diagram does not meet its consistency test. In other words, this object isn’t in a state LabVIEW expects it to be in. Most of the time these errors are not fatal — LabVIEW simply puts the object in the state it does expect.

What are some examples of people faking insanity?

One famous example of someone feigning insanity is Mafia boss Vincent Gigante, who pretended for years to be suffering from dementia, and was often seen wandering aimlessly around his neighborhood in his pajamas muttering to himself.
